(2005) is a biographical war drama that offers a raw, psychological look at the life of a U.S. Marine during the Persian Gulf War. Based on the 2003 memoir by Anthony Swofford, the film deviates from traditional action-heavy war movies by focusing on the intense boredom, isolation, and mental strain experienced by soldiers waiting for a combat that never seems to arrive. The film is often cited as an "anti-war" story because it strips away the heroism usually associated with the genre. Roger Ebert noted that it "rises above the war and tells a soldier's story," emphasizing the permanence of the military identity—once a "Jarhead," always a "Jarhead".
